Trivia:
Filipinos have paydays twice a month, and it is the national character of the majority of people to withdraw almost all of their money on payday and spend it lavishly.
The Philippines uses the peso, which is common in former Spanish colonies.
Traditionally a country where people go to work, remittances from people living abroad are an important way to acquire foreign currency.
The new banknotes issued in 2010 were commissioned to a printing company in France, but a mistake in the motif on the banknotes caused controversy.
